Data Analytics Experience
As a data analyst, I work across the full analytics lifecycle: from understanding the business question, to collecting and cleaning data, to building models and communicating results to non‑technical stakeholders. I primarily use Excel for data entry, calculations, spreadsheets, and day‑to‑day analysis, and Power BI for interactive dashboards, large‑dataset visualization, and real‑time business reports.
I leverage the strengths of both tools: Excel for quick, ad‑hoc analysis, financial modelling, and scenario planning, and Power BI for scalable, automated analytics and collaborative dashboards that let teams explore data visually. My focus is on clarity: clear assumptions, clear data models, and clear explanations for decision‑makers.
